Uta Arad Claims Victory in Tense Match Against Universitatea Cluj
Cluj-Napoca, December 2nd, 2024.- Uta Arad secured a 1-0 victory over Universitatea Cluj at the Cluj Arena in a fiercely contested Romanian Liga I matchday 18 clash. The match, officiated by Marian Barbu, saw Universitatea Cluj dominate possession with 71%, while Uta Arad held onto 29%. Despite this significant possession advantage, Universitatea Cluj struggled to convert chances, managing only 7 shots on target from a total of 22 attempts. Uta Arad proved more clinical, scoring the only goal of the game in the 29th minute through J. A. Kadiri, assisted by R. Trif.
The game was also characterized by a high number of yellow cards. Universitatea Cluj received 3, while Uta Arad accumulated 5. Universitatea Cluj’s lack of clinical finishing, coupled with Uta Arad’s effectiveness and strong defense, ultimately decided the outcome. Despite having 10 corner kicks, Universitatea Cluj failed to capitalize on their opportunities, leading to their defeat.
